Where does “gleme” come from?
gleme (Middle English) comes from Old English glæm, from Proto-Germanic glaimiz, from Proto-Indo-European ǵʰley-, from Proto-Indo-European ǵʰel- — to shine, glimmer, glow; to shimmer, gleam;...
